TNA Sacrifice 2012

6.0
20122h 48m

Sacrifice (2012) was a professional wrestling pay-per-view (PPV) event produced by the Total Nonstop Action Wrestling (TNA) promotion, which took place on May 13, 2012 at the Impact Wrestling Zone in Orlando, Florida.[2] It was the eighth show under the Sacrifice chronology and fifth event in the 2012 TNA PPV schedule.

Production

Logo for Total Nonstop Action (TNA)

Cast

Photo of Robert Roode Jr.

Robert Roode Jr.

Bobby Roode

Photo of Rob Szatkowski

Rob Szatkowski

Rob Van Dam

Photo of Kurt Angle

Kurt Angle

Himself

Photo of Allen Jones

Allen Jones

AJ Styles

Photo of Mark LoMonaco

Mark LoMonaco

Bully Ray

Photo of Daniel Solwold Jr.

Daniel Solwold Jr.

Austin Aries

Photo of Jeremy Fritz

Jeremy Fritz

Eric Young

Photo of Jeff Hardy

Jeff Hardy

Jeff Hardy

Photo of Ken Anderson

Ken Anderson

Mr. Anderson

Photo of Rob Strauss

Rob Strauss

Robbie E.

Photo of Robert Terry

Robert Terry

Robbie T.

Photo of Brooke Adams

Brooke Adams

Brooke Tessmacher

Photo of Gail Kim

Gail Kim

Gail Kim

Photo of Daniel Covell

Daniel Covell

Christopher Daniels

Photo of Jessica Kresa

Jessica Kresa

ODB (Ringside)

More Like This

Reviews

No reviews available yet.